Lower Face & Neck Lift

Lower face and neck procedures remain some of the most common aesthetic treatments in the industry. As we age, gravity slowly pulls down on our skin and our tissue gradually loses elasticity, causing the lower face and neck to appear saggy. This skin laxity can be addressed through excisional surgery with a face or neck lift, which pulls and tightens the skin. But, due to excessive costs and painful downtime many patients are looking for non-surgical options to lift and contour their jawlines and neck.

Evoke leverages clinically proven radiofrequency technology to deliver volumetric heating deep in the skin’s subdermal layers. By directly addressing the jowls and neck, Evoke can help you achieve more defined facial characteristics. Evoke is the ideal treatment for patients looking to lift and tighten their neck and jawline or get rid of that double chin with a non-invasive, painless procedure. Unlike Kybella, which is an injectable treatment that can leave the neck swollen for up to 6 months, Evoke is able to dissolve fatty tissue under the chin and tighten the skin on the neck and lower face with absolutely no downtime.

The Evoke technology uses non-invasive electrodes to deliver radiofrequency energy to heat the subdermal layers. This energy is able to target and destroy the pockets of fatty tissue causing submental fullness or double chin. The RF energy also targets and shrinks the skin's collagen and elastin fibers, causing the skin to contract and tighten. The procedure is carried out over a series of 4 to 6 treatments, spaced 1 to 2 weeks apart, as recommended by your provider.

HOW SAFE IS THE TREATMENT?

 

Evoke is recommended for patients who are seeking non-invasive facial remodeling treatments. Evoke improves blood circulation and will provide a natural-looking younger facial appearance. It is a very safe and effective procedure that can be used on all skin types and skin tones. Evoke is designed with a Patient Call Button so you can easily pause your treatment at any time and have clinic staff make adjustments to ensure your comfort.

 

DOES THE EVOKE TREATMENT HURT?

 

Evoke treatments are very comfortable. During your treatment you can expect a warming of your skin similar to a warm facial. It is a quick and painless treatment that can be done over lunch time. You will be able to sit upright and can surf the internet, read a book, or watch TV, while treatments to restore youth are being performed.

 

HOW MANY SESSIONS ARE RECOMMENDED?

 

Your practitioner will recommend the optimal number of sessions to be performed based on your personal objectives. Treatment times and frequency will be specifically tailored to obtain the optimal results. You will begin to see gradual improvements in the treatment area following your first few sessions.

 

WHAT KIND OF POST PROCEDURE CARE IS REQUIRED?

 

There is absolutely no recovery period or downtime associated with Evoke. It is a quick and painless treatment that can be done over your lunch time, allowing you to return to your normal activities immediately.
